Phylogenetic tree generated from maximum likelihood (ML) analysis based on the combined LSU, ITS, tef 1 - α, and rpb 2 sequence data. Bootstrap support values for ML (≥ 70 %) and BYPP (≥ 0.95) are indicated near their respective nodes. Both Maximum Likelihood (ML) and Bayesian Inference (BYPP) analyses produced congruent topologies. A hyphen (“ - ”) indicates a value lower than 70 % for ML and a posterior probability lower than 0.95 for Bayesian inference. The tree is rooted with Helicotubeufia hydei (MFLUCC 17-1980) and H. jonesii (MFLUCC 17-0043). Ex-type strains are denoted with “ T, ” and newly obtained strains are in bold black fonts.	Figure 1.
